A solar meter, also known as a solar irradiance meter or pyranometer, is a device that measures the amount of solar energy or irradiance that is being emitted by the sun. It is commonly used in solar power applications to optimize system performance and ensure that it is operating. . A junction box (often called a “J-box”) is a protective enclosure used in solar PV systems to house electrical connections, splices, and terminals. This device plays a significant role in both residential and commercial solar installations, particularly when. . A solar combiner box gathers multiple solar panel strings into one output, adds protection and monitoring, and feeds the combined DC power to an inverter safely and efficiently. The. . To seal solar panel connections against water, you'll primarily use silicone-based sealants, butyl tape, or weatherproof junction boxes. Silicone sealants offer durability and UV resistance, while butyl tape provides flexibility for temperature changes. Weatherproof junction boxes with high IP. .
